    Don’t Settle – Demand the Best Cement Mixer Repairs

    When it comes to sourcing cement mixer repairs, you can’t afford to work with amateurs. You need to get your systems back up in as little time as possible, and you need to minimise downtime as much as possible. It’s because of this that you have to insist on working with the best.

    One way of doing this, and of making sure you get the beset cement mixer repairs available on the market, is to make sure you know who you’re dealing with. Your supplier should have confidence in their own work, and display this confidence by providing you with an excellent guarantee and warranty on all services rendered.

    After all, if they don’t have trust in their own work, then why should you have any? This is just one way that you can make sure you are indeed dealing with true industry professionals. Never settle for anything other than the best services available.
